Why is sufficient margin width required on valve margins?

Sufficient margin width on valve margins is important to prevent burning and warping of the valve. When a valve is subjected to high temperatures and pressures during operation, the margins help maintain the integrity of the valve by providing enough material to absorb heat and resist deformation. If the margin is too narrow, it can lead to localized overheating, which can cause the valve to warp or burn, compromising its functionality and efficiency. A well-designed margin width ensures that the valve can withstand the thermal stresses it encounters within the engine, contributing to the overall reliability and durability of the equipment.
